A Nevada jury recently awarded $1.3 million in damages to comedian George Wallace for a leg injury he said he suffered while performing at a Las Vegas Strip resort in 2007. The 61-year-old stand-up comic known to many as Jerry Seinfeld’s friend had sought at least $7.1 million, but he emerged from the courtroom Tuesday saying […]

Rapper 50 Cent, aka Curtis Jackson III is being sued by Sleek Audio, the company he choose to design and manufacture his line of over-the-ear headphones.
